Argininosuccinate is a non-proteinogenic amino acid . The L - isomer is an intermediate product in the urea cycle and is formed there from citrulline and aspartate, catalyzed by argininosuccinate synthase with consumption of ATP . In the further course of the cycle, argininosuccinate is broken down into fumarate and arginine by the argininosuccinate lyase .

On the other hand, the argininosuccinate can also first be converted into fumarate and then into malate , which can be fed into the citric acid cycle . In this respect, argininosuccinate is an important link between the urea cycle and the citric acid cycle.
